Röhr GmbH is a company that plays a leading role in the wood industry – both in the DACH region and beyond. Founded about 30 years ago by Josef Röhr, a man full of ideas and a special affinity for wood material, the company is now led by his daughter-in-law Marina. Marina Röhr, who originally comes from the fashion industry and brings a passion for aesthetics and sustainability, has managed to modernize Röhr GmbH while staying true to its original values. 

Origins in the Wood Business

Formerly working as a wood representative for an Italian company, Josef Röhr decided to become self-employed when he came across an old kitchen production in Slovakia. He quickly transformed this facility into a manufacturing site for custom-made wood panels. "My father-in-law was a modest person, but he had big dreams," recalls Marina Röhr. "He believed in the power of wood and that it could beautify people's everyday lives."

Marina Röhr, Managing Director of Röhr GmbH
Marina Röhr, Managing Director of Röhr GmbH

After his son Reinhold joined the company, Röhr GmbH was further expanded and developed into a major player in the timber sector through investments in production and a strategic realignment. However, Reinhold Röhr tragically passed away six years ago, and Marina Röhr decided to continue the family tradition. "It was a difficult path, but I wanted to continue the company in the spirit of the family and give it a personal touch," she says.

Innovation and Sustainability as Core Elements

Since Marina Röhr has taken over leadership, Röhr GmbH and the brand europlac® have continuously evolved. "Our goal is not only to produce high-quality products but also to work in a sustainable manner and set new standards," says the CEO. In the Slovakian production facility, a lot has been invested in automation and digitalization in recent years – including a fully automatic painting system. Currently, an innovative exhibition that will showcase the diversity of the products in a modern way is being developed at the company's headquarters in Tettnang by Lake Constance. Röhr GmbH offers a wide range of wood products that go far beyond standard panels. In addition to fire protection panels and acoustic solutions, the range also includes innovative products like DOLLYWOOD®, a combination of Tyrolean sheep wool and wood, especially developed for use in hotels and high-end interior designs. "I enjoy playing with different materials and combining them with wood to create unique products," explains the CEO. This combination of tradition and innovation is reflected throughout the entire product range. Sustainability is also a central aspect of the company's philosophy. "Wood is a renewable resource, and we are committed to carefully utilizing this valuable resource," she emphasizes. The company works with recyclable materials and offers products like colored veneers specially developed for kindergartens and hospitals. "We want our customers to experience nature even in urban spaces," Marina Röhr clarifies. This reconnection with nature and respect for the environment and resources are deeply embedded in the company culture.

A Family Business with Heart

Although Röhr GmbH is successful in international markets, the company remains true to its family roots. With 30 employees in Tettnang and around 270 in production in Slovakia, Röhr GmbH is large enough to handle international projects, yet small enough to maintain personal contact. "It is a strength of our company that our employees and customers feel like a family," explains the Managing Director. The flat hierarchies also contribute to employees feeling valued and able to act on their own responsibility. For Röhr GmbH, the future is marked by innovation and growth.
